PROTOCOL FOR THE SELECTION AND RENEWAL OF POSITIONS
Investigaciones Históricas. Época moderna y contemporánea has an editorial team consisting of a Director, Editorial Secretariat, Editorial Board and Advisory Board.
The Editorial Secretariat is made up of four editorial secretaries, two for Modern History and two for Contemporary History. The Director, Editorial Secretaries and half of the Editorial Board are members of the Modern History and Contemporary History departments at the University of Valladolid, and since 2024, a professor from the American History department has joined the board due to the growing number of articles received from across the Atlantic. The other half of the Editorial Board are members of the Modern and Contemporary History departments of the region's universities (Burgos, Salamanca and León). The Advisory Board is made up of renowned national and international specialists.
The composition of the journal's members respects the balance between genders and between the areas of knowledge of Modern and Contemporary History.
All members are elected and reappointed on the recommendation of the Modern, Contemporary and American History departments of the University of Valladolid, based on their merits and commitment, and are approved or dismissed at the annual meeting of the Journal Council, which also approves the publication of the annual issue, proposals for monographs and the journal's guidelines. Any member may be dismissed at their own request or for failure to fulfil their duties. The list of positions and members of the journal is updated annually on the journal's website.
The Director, Editorial Secretariat and Editorial Board ensure the journal's quality standards. The Director oversees the proper functioning of the journal, its website and its positioning. The Editorial Board and Advisory Board act as internal reviewers to select the articles submitted to the journal. The Editorial Secretariat handles the double-blind external evaluation of articles and communicates with authors.
